[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Groff-commit] groff ./ChangeLog src/libs/libdriver/input.cpp
From: |
Werner LEMBERG |
Subject: |
[Groff-commit] groff ./ChangeLog src/libs/libdriver/input.cpp |
Date: |
Wed, 26 Apr 2006 08:16:51 +0000 |
CVSROOT: /cvsroot/groff
Module name: groff
Branch:
Changes by: Werner LEMBERG <address@hidden> 06/04/26 08:16:51
Modified files:
. : ChangeLog
src/libs/libdriver: input.cpp
Log message:
* src/libs/libdriver/input.cpp (parse_x_command <'F'>, do_file
<'F'>): Use `get_extended_arg' to behave as documented. Reported by
Bill Ward <address@hidden>.
CVSWeb URLs:
http://cvs.savannah.gnu.org/viewcvs/groff/groff/ChangeLog.diff?tr1=1.951&tr2=1.952&r1=text&r2=text
http://cvs.savannah.gnu.org/viewcvs/groff/groff/src/libs/libdriver/input.cpp.diff?tr1=1.6&tr2=1.7&r1=text&r2=text
Patches:
Index: groff/ChangeLog
diff -u groff/ChangeLog:1.951 groff/ChangeLog:1.952
--- groff/ChangeLog:1.951 Wed Apr 26 07:41:33 2006
+++ groff/ChangeLog Wed Apr 26 08:16:51 2006
@@ -3,6 +3,10 @@
* src/devices/grohtml/post-html.cpp (html_printer::~html_printer):
Handle current_paragraph only if it is non-NULL.
+ * src/libs/libdriver/input.cpp (parse_x_command <'F'>, do_file
+ <'F'>): Use `get_extended_arg' to behave as documented. Reported by
+ Bill Ward <address@hidden>.
+
Surround the (pseudo) file name for the .pso request with `<' and
`>'.
Index: groff/src/libs/libdriver/input.cpp
diff -u groff/src/libs/libdriver/input.cpp:1.6
groff/src/libs/libdriver/input.cpp:1.7
--- groff/src/libs/libdriver/input.cpp:1.6 Thu Jun 16 09:47:49 2005
+++ groff/src/libs/libdriver/input.cpp Wed Apr 26 08:16:51 2006
@@ -2,7 +2,7 @@
// <groff_src_dir>/src/libs/libdriver/input.cpp
-/* Copyright (C) 1989, 1990, 1991, 1992, 2001, 2002, 2003, 2004, 2005
+/* Copyright (C) 1989, 1990, 1991, 1992, 2001, 2002, 2003, 2004, 2005, 2006
Free Software Foundation, Inc.
Written by James Clark (address@hidden)
@@ -1466,7 +1466,7 @@
}
case 'F': // x Filename: set filename for errors
{
- char *str_arg = get_string_arg();
+ char *str_arg = get_extended_arg();
if (str_arg == 0)
warning("empty argument for `x F' command");
else {
@@ -1733,7 +1733,7 @@
break;
case 'F': // F: obsolete, replaced by `x F'
{
- char *str_arg = get_string_arg();
+ char *str_arg = get_extended_arg();
remember_source_filename(str_arg);
a_delete str_arg;
break;
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[Groff-commit] groff ./ChangeLog src/libs/libdriver/input.cpp,
Werner LEMBERG <=